Clear victory against Huétor Tájar (4-1)

Atlético Malagueño achieved a superb victory against Huétor Tájar in the ninth match for Third Division Group IX. The 4-1 win leaves Josep Clotet’s boys in second place in the Division.

The Blue and Whites reserve team were intent on dominating the match from the start, and continuing with their good run of results.  Malagueño didn’t hesitate in taking control of the game, creating goal chances and completely dominating their rival.
 
Following various goal opportunities, it was Emilio Guerra who scored in the 17th minute from outside the penalty area, straight past the Huétor Tájar keeper.  Atlético Malagueño put on an impressive display, with Samu García taking advantage of another goal opportunity after half an hour.  Clotet’s team then slowed down the pace a little, creating fewer chances to score.
 
The Blue and Whites got off to another great start in the second half, keeping the pressure on the opponent.  However a goal from Antonio in the 64th minute put Huétor Tájar on the score board for the first time in this match.  A third goal for Malagueño by Jurado in minute 84 saw them gain a 3-1 lead, though a subsequent header straight into goal by Diego sealed Atlético Malagueño’s victory, leaving them in second position in the Division.
